Chlamydomonas Genetics Center, Duke University, 1980

From a cross of CC-1039 wild type nit+ mt+ [Sager’s 21 gr, stock subsequently replaced by CC-1690] x CC-1065 nit2 sr-u-sm2 mt-

Whereas most strains in the 137c background have both the nit1-137 and nit2-137 mutations, his strain provides the nit2-137 allele by itself..
